Apple Silicon处理器的代码示例

69 阅读1分钟

首先看看即将推出的Apple Silicon处理器,以及我们Ruby开发人员会是什么样子。老实说,我希望这是一个更好的体验。然而,随着macOS Big Sur成为测试版,DTK不是最终的消费者硬件,仍然有希望。

# Install Homebrew
sudo xcodebuild -license

cd "$(mktemp -d)" \
  && git clone https://github.com/ruby/fiddle \
  && cd fiddle \
  && bundle install --path vendor/bundle \
  && bundle exec rake build \
  && sudo gem install pkg/fiddle-1.0.1.gem

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"
# Install oh-my-zsh
curl -L https://raw.github.com/robbyrussell/oh-my-zsh/master/tools/install.sh | sh
zsh
chmod -R 755 /usr/local/share/zsh
# Install asdf and Ruby
brew install coreutils curl git
brew install asdf
echo ". $(brew --prefix asdf)/asdf.sh" >> ~/.zshrc
asdf plugin-add ruby https://github.com/asdf-vm/asdf-ruby.git
asdf install ruby 2.7.1